Line in matlab.

Themen. Create a 2-D line plot and specify the line style, line color, and marker type. Add markers to a line plot to distinguish multiple lines or to highlight particular data points. …

Line in matlab. Things To Know About Line in matlab.

Split a string at a newline character. When the literal represents a newline character, convert it to an actual newline using the compose function. Then use splitlines to split the string at the newline character. Create a string in which two lines of text are separated by . You can use + to concatenate text onto the end of a string. Aug 2, 2017 · How can change transparency and thickness of a line in Matlab. Follow 318 views (last 30 days) Show older comments. amir nemat on 2 Aug 2017. Vote. 2. Link. Copy. % Get coefficients of a line fit through the data. coefficients = polyfit (x, y, 1); % Create a new x axis with exactly 1000 points (or whatever you want). xFit = linspace (min (x), max (x), 1000); % Get the estimated yFit value for each of those 1000 new x locations. yFit = polyval (coefficients , xFit); % Plot everything.Labels and Annotations. Add titles, axis labels, informative text, and other graph annotations. Add a title, label the axes, or add annotations to a graph to help convey important information. You can create a legend to label plotted data series or add descriptive text next to data points. Also, you can create annotations such as rectangles ...

Continue Long Statements on Multiple Lines. This example shows how to continue a statement to the next line using ellipsis ( ... ). Build a long character vector by concatenating shorter vectors together: mytext = ['Accelerating the pace of ' ... 'engineering and science']; The start and end quotation marks for a character vector must appear on ...Description. fcontour (f) plots the contour lines of the function z = f (x,y) for constant levels of z over the default interval [-5 5] for x and y. fcontour (f,xyinterval) plots over the specified interval. To use the same interval for both x and y , specify xyinterval as a two-element vector of the form [min max].

For this example. plot the root-locus of the following SISO dynamic system: s y s ( s) = 2 s 2 + 5 s + 1 s 2 + 2 s + 3. sys = tf ( [2 5 1], [1 2 3]); rlocus (sys) The poles of the system are denoted by x, while the zeros are denoted by o on the root locus plot. You can use the menu within the generated root locus plot to add grid lines, zoom in ...

Copy. [cs,hc]=contourf (args); set (hc,'EdgeColor','none') Sign in to comment. Sign in to answer this question. Lately I purchased a 2017a student licence. Until then I used the institution's licence for 2016a where I could have lines invisible by setting "linewidth" to zero. The 2017a version alerts for ...Alternatively, you can press the F12 key to set a breakpoint at the current line. If you attempt to set a breakpoint at a line that is not executable, such as a comment or a blank line, MATLAB sets it at the next executable line. To set a standard breakpoint programmatically, use the dbstop function.Line width, specified as a positive value in points, where 1 point = 1/72 of an inch. If the line has markers, then the line width also affects the marker edges. The line width cannot be thinner than the width of a pixel.Description example yline (y) creates a horizontal line at one or more y -coordinates in the current axes. For example, yline (2) creates a line at y=2. example yline (y,LineSpec) specifies the line style, the line color, or both. For example, yline ( [12 20 33],'--b') creates three dashed blue lines. example

line (MATLAB Functions) line (X,Y) line (X,Y,Z) line (X,Y,Z,' ',PropertyValue,...) ',PropertyValue,...) low-level-PN/PV pairs only creates a line object in the current axes. You can specify the color, width, line …

If you want to plot both markers and a line, you can use the plot function and specify a line style that includes marker symbols and a line style, such as '-x'. For example, this code plots a line with crosses at the data points. Theme. Copy. plot (x,y,'-x') If you are trying to plot only the first eight points, then use this code instead: Theme.

User Defined Inline Functions: MATLAB provides the option to define inline functions in the script using the inline keyword. The syntax for the same is. function_name = inline ('expression', 'variable') The expression is the function's expression and the variable is the independent variable of the function. Example 2:Fit the axes box tightly around the data by setting the axis limits to the data range. Fit the axes box around the data with a thin margin of padding on each side. The width of the margin is approximately 7% of the data range. Limit mode, specified as one of the following values: property of the axes. If you plot into the axes multiple times ...Theme. Copy. y = C (1)*x + C (2)*x^2 + C (3)*x^3 + C (4)*x^4. That forces the curve to pass through zero, has a bump at the bottom end, etc. But it has a little tweak near the top. Theme. Copy. spl = spline (x,y); plot (x,y,'o',xint,ppval (spl,xint),'r-')The MATLAB plot gallery provides various examples to display data graphically in MATLAB. Click Launch example below to open and run the live script examples in your browser with MATLAB Online™. For more options, visit MATLAB Live Script Gallery to run live script examples from the MATLAB Community. Download code.Dec 7, 2014 · I see 4 lines. Anyway, extract the x and y coordinates that you want to fit a line to, then use polyfit: Theme. Copy. coefficients = polyfit (x, y, 1); % Now get the slope, which is the first coefficient in the array: slope = coefficients (1); 6 Comments. Show 5 older comments.

red is the facecolor (PolyGon Color) of patch we passed in the 3rd argument of the function. and black is by defailt EdgeColor of patch object. To change EdgeColor we can. Theme. Copy. figure,plot (1:3, [1 -1 1],'r','EdgeColor','c') Now if we just want to draw the line and not the area patch is covering. Theme.Matlab plot segment [limited lines by two points] I googled it... And all i found was how to plot a line that crosses two points, what i need is Segment ( Line that crosses two points A (x1, y1) and B (x2, y2) but limited with those two points) if somebody can give me a function that does that, i will thankful.Draw a line. Learn more about line, plot . Community Treasure Hunt. Find the treasures in MATLAB Central and discover how the community can help you!May 26, 2023 · Accepted Answer. To plot two lines with different line widths, you can use either of these approaches. 1. Return the two “Line” objects as an output argument from the “plot” function and then set the “LineWidth” property for each. 2. Use the “hold on” command to plot the two lines separately. MATLAB® cycles the line color through the default color order. Specify Line Style, Color, and Marker. Plot three sine curves with a small phase shift between each line. Use a green line with no markers for the first sine curve. Use a blue dashed line with circle markers for the second sine curve. Use only cyan star markers for the third sine ...Next, call the nexttile function to create an Axes object and return it as ax1. Display an area plot by passing ax1 to the area function. tiledlayout ( 'flow' ) ax1 = nexttile; Y1 = [3 6; 1 5; 7 2; 5 9]; area (ax1,Y1) Repeat the process to create a second Axes object and a second area plot.

5 Answers Sorted by: 9 You could actually use xlsread to accomplish this. After first placing your sample data above in a file 'input_file.csv', here is an example for …

Many plotting commands accept a LineSpec argument that defines three components used to specify lines: Line style. Marker symbol. Color. For example, plot (x,y,'-.or') plots y versus x using a dash-dot line (-. ), places circular markers ( o) at the data points, and colors both line and marker red ( r ). Specify the components (in any order) as ...Name,Value pair settings apply to all the lines plotted. You cannot specify different Name,Value pairs for each line using this syntax. Instead, return the chart line objects and use dot notation to set the properties for each line. The properties listed here are only a subset. For a full list, see Line Properties. Specify Line and Marker Appearance in Plots. MATLAB ® creates plots using a default set of line styles, colors, and markers. These defaults provide a clean and consistent look …Description example yline (y) creates a horizontal line at one or more y -coordinates in the current axes. For example, yline (2) creates a line at y=2. example yline (y,LineSpec) specifies the line style, the line color, or both. For example, yline ( [12 20 33],'--b') creates three dashed blue lines. exampleTheme. Copy. y = C (1)*x + C (2)*x^2 + C (3)*x^3 + C (4)*x^4. That forces the curve to pass through zero, has a bump at the bottom end, etc. But it has a little tweak near the top. Theme. Copy. spl = spline (x,y); plot (x,y,'o',xint,ppval (spl,xint),'r-')contour (Z) creates a contour plot containing the isolines of matrix Z, where Z contains height values on the x - y plane. MATLAB ® automatically selects the contour lines to display. The column and row indices of Z are the x and y coordinates in the plane, respectively. example. contour (X,Y,Z) specifies the x and y coordinates for the values ...Create a newline character. Then use + to concatenate the newline character and more text onto the end of a string. str = "In Xanadu did Kubla Khan" ; str = str + newline + "A stately pleasure-dome decree". str = "In Xanadu did Kubla Khan A stately pleasure-dome decree". Although str displays on two lines, str is a 1-by-1 string. Insert Circle and Filled Shapes onto Image. Read an image into the workspace. I = imread ( "peppers.png" ); Place a circle on the image with a border line width of 5 pixels. RGB = insertShape (I, "circle" , [150 280 35],LineWidth=5); Place a filled triangle and a filled hexagon on the image.

If you want to plot both markers and a line, you can use the plot function and specify a line style that includes marker symbols and a line style, such as '-x'. For example, this code plots a line with crosses at the data points. Theme. Copy. plot (x,y,'-x') If you are trying to plot only the first eight points, then use this code instead: Theme.

The simplest way to draw a line onto an image is to use PLOT. %# read and display image img = imread ('autumn.tif'); figure,imshow (img) %# make sure the image doesn't disappear if we plot something else hold on %# define points (in matrix coordinates) p1 = [10,100]; p2 = [100,20]; %# plot the points. %# Note that depending on the definition of ...

In this published M-file, we will use MATLAB to solve problems about lines and planes in three-dimensional space. The mathematical content corresponds to chapter 11 of the text by Gulick and Ellis. We begin with the problem of finding the equation of a plane through three points. Example 1: Find an equation for the plane through the points (1 ...Example 1: Find an equation for the plane through the points (1,-1,3), (2,3,4), and (-5,6,7). We begin by creating MATLAB arrays that represent the three points ...How to draw a line on an image in matlab? Ask Question Asked 13 years, 2 months ago Modified 6 years, 11 months ago Viewed 106k times 21 I have two points lets say: P (x,y) …Description example yline (y) creates a horizontal line at one or more y -coordinates in the current axes. For example, yline (2) creates a line at y=2. example yline (y,LineSpec) specifies the line style, the line color, or both. For example, yline ( [12 20 33],'--b') creates three dashed blue lines. example1 Answer Sorted by: 4 From the Matlab documentation: plot (___,Name,Value) specifies line properties using one or more Name,Value pair arguments. Use this option with any of the input argument combinations in the previous syntaxes. Name,Value pair settings apply to all the lines plotted.S = readlines (filename) creates an N-by-1 string array by reading an N-line file. example. S = readlines (filename,Name,Value) creates a string array from a file with additional options specified by one or more name-value pair arguments. For example, 'EmptyLineRule','skip' skips empty lines.Description. clc clears all the text from the Command Window, resulting in a clear screen. After running clc, you cannot use the scroll bar in the Command Window to see previously displayed text. You can, however, use the up-arrow key ↑ in the Command Window to recall statements from the command history. Use clc in a MATLAB ® code file to ...contour (Z) creates a contour plot containing the isolines of matrix Z, where Z contains height values on the x - y plane. MATLAB ® automatically selects the contour lines to display. The column and row indices of Z are the x and y coordinates in the plane, respectively. example. contour (X,Y,Z) specifies the x and y coordinates for the values ... Insert Circle and Filled Shapes onto Image. Read an image into the workspace. I = imread ( "peppers.png" ); Place a circle on the image with a border line width of 5 pixels. RGB = insertShape (I, "circle" , [150 280 35],LineWidth=5); Place a filled triangle and a filled hexagon on the image.User Defined Inline Functions: MATLAB provides the option to define inline functions in the script using the inline keyword. The syntax for the same is. function_name = inline ('expression', 'variable') The expression is the function's expression and the variable is the independent variable of the function. Example 2:

plot (X,Y) creates a 2-D line plot of the data in Y versus the corresponding values in X. To plot a set of coordinates connected by line segments, specify X and Y as vectors of the same length. To plot multiple sets of coordinates on the same set of axes, specify at least one of X or Y as a matrix.MATLAB® cycles the line color through the default color order. Specify Line Style, Color, and Marker. Plot three sine curves with a small phase shift between each line. Use a green line with no markers for the first sine curve. Use a blue dashed line with circle markers for the second sine curve. Use only cyan star markers for the third sine ...Oct 31, 2021 · Output: You can plot a horizontal line on an existing graph by using the yline () function after the plot () function. Please make sure the vertical position used to plot the horizontal line is present on the graph; otherwise, we will not see the line because it will be on the graph’s edge. We cannot set the length of the line using the yline ... Instagram:https://instagram. robin's lost axe stardew valley expandedsummer waves 13 ft poolblock tax advisorsbbc london temperature Gridded and scattered data interpolation, data gridding, piecewise polynomials. Interpolation is a technique for adding new data points within a range of a set of known data points. You can use interpolation to fill-in missing data, smooth existing data, make predictions, and more. Interpolation in MATLAB ® is divided into techniques for data ... I would like to draw [x1 x2],[y1 y2] line segments, and I have data in the form X1(i) = x1 etc. and i=1:1000; Is it possible to draw the lines without a for cycle? craigslist kauai toolslast night college football scores 2 Answers Sorted by: 18 use sprinf and \n (newline character) n = input (sprintf ( ['The matrix is diagonally dominant. Please choose which method you wish to\n'... ' use: 1 (Gaussian elimination), 2 (Jacobi iterations),\n'... ' 3 (Gauss-Seidel iterations). If you enter any other number\n'...Description. example. [xi,yi] = polyxpoly (x1,y1,x2,y2) returns the intersection points of two polylines in a planar, Cartesian system, with vertices defined by x1, y1 , x2 and y2. The output arguments, xi and yi, contain the x - and y -coordinates of each point at which a segment of the first polyline intersects a segment of the second. mangapaek 13 พ.ค. 2561 ... I'll consider making it an option to let users choose which one they prefer. This would allow users to backup if Matlab doesn't behave as it ...Title with Variable Value. Include a variable value in the title text by using the num2str function to convert the value to text. You can use a similar approach to add variable values to axis labels or legend entries. Add a title with the value of sin ( π) / 2. k = sin (pi/2); title ( [ 'sin (\pi/2) = ' num2str (k)])